"THE MOST AMAZING, ENDURING AND ENDEARING ONE-MAN FEAT"

JOHNSON, Samuel. A Dictionary of the English Language. London, 1755. Two volumes.

First edition of the first great dictionary of the English language, Johnson's "audacious attempt to tame his unruly native tongue… combining huge erudition with a steely wit and remarkable clarity of thought" (Hitchings, 3)—"Johnson's writings had, in philology, the effect which Newton's discoveries had in mathematics." $27,500.

"THE MADNESS OF INDEPENDENCE HAS SPREAD": FIRST COLLECTED EDITION OF SAMUEL JOHNSON’S CONTROVERSIAL POLITICAL TRACTS, 1776

JOHNSON, Samuel. Political Tracts. London, 1776.

First edition of Johnson's four anonymously published political tracts, together in one volume for the first time, False Alarm (1770), Falkland's Islands (1771), The Patriot (1774) and Taxation No Tyranny (1775), his provocative attack on American colonists and the First Continental Congress. $2500.

"THE GREATEST MASTERPIECE OF ENGLISH 18TH-CENTURY CRITICISM"

JOHNSON, Samuel. Lives of the Most Eminent English Poets. London, 1783. Four volumes.

1783 edition of Johnson's celebrated Lives of the Poets—"the only edition of importance after the first. It is the only edition which Johnson revised, and the last he lived to see"—with engraved frontispiece portrait after Sir Joshua Reynolds, a splendid four-volumes in scarce contemporary polished calf. $1750.
